Description of key information

LogPow = -0.713 for methylamine in aqueous solution

Key value for chemical safety assessment

Log Kow (Log Pow):
-0.713
at the temperature of:
25 °C

Additional information

Given that the substance is in solution in water, it is expected to present the same range in the partition coefficient as its organic component: methylammonium. The logPow reported for methylamine in aqueous solution is negative, so the logPow of MMAN is also expected to be negative. This implies that MMAN has a very low Kow (lower than 10), indicating a great hydrosolubility potential. This is coherent with the state in aqueous solution. Therefore, the partition coefficient octanol/water does not need to be further assessed.
